What This Book Is About
Mindful awareness isn’t about emptying your mind or achieving perfect peace—it’s about learning to observe your thoughts, emotions, and experiences without judgment. It’s a skill that helps you:

- Reduce stress and anxiety by stepping out of autopilot reactions
- Improve focus and clarity by training your attention like a muscle
- Deepen self-awareness by noticing habits and patterns that hold you back
- Find joy in everyday moments by fully experiencing life as it unfolds

How to Use This Book
This isn’t a rigid instruction manual—it’s an invitation to experiment. Each chapter includes:
- Real-life examples (including my own struggles with mindfulness)
- Simple exercises to try in the moment
- Gentle reminders to bring you back to awareness

You don’t need hours of meditation or a perfectly quiet mind. You just need willingness to pause, notice, and return to the present—again and again.
